function verifFormContact(){
	if(document.contact.mail.value == "") {alert("Veuillez entrer votre adresse electronique!"); document.contact.mail.focus(); return false;}
if (document.contact.mail.value.length < 5) {alert("Veuillez saisir une adresse electronique valide !"); document.contact.mail.focus(); return false;}
if (document.contact.mail.value.indexOf(',') > 0) {alert("Veuillez saisir une adresse electronique valide !"); document.contact.mail.focus(); return false;}
if (document.contact.mail.value.indexOf(';') > 0) {alert("Veuillez saisir une adresse electronique valide !"); document.contact.mail.focus(); return false;}
if (document.contact.mail.value.indexOf('@') < 0) {alert("Veuillez saisir une adresse electronique valide !"); document.contact.mail.focus(); return false;}

var mailparts = document.contact.mail.value.split('@');
if (mailparts[0].length < 1) {alert("Veuillez saisir une adresse electronique valide !"); document.contact.mail.focus(); return false;}
if (mailparts[1].indexOf('.') < 0) {alert("Veuillez saisir une adresse electronique valide !");	document.contact.mail.focus(); return false;}

var domaine = mailparts[1].split('.');
if (domaine[0].length < 1) {alert("Veuillez saisir une adresse electronique valide !"); document.contact.mail.focus(); return false;}
if (domaine[1].length < 2) {alert("Veuillez saisir une adresse electronique valide !"); document.contact.mail.focus(); return false;}

	if(document.contact.objet.value == "") {alert("Veuillez saisir l'objet de votre message."); document.contact.objet.focus(); return false;}
	
	if(document.contact.txt_msg.value == "") {alert("Veuillez saisir de votre message."); document.contact.txt_msg.focus(); return false;}
	return true;
}
